Transportation requires more than knowing a route. Students practice timing, transfers, appointments, work schedules, errands, communication, and contingency planning.
Community access is part of practical independence.
Identify departure time and what is needed.
Choose route and account for travel time.
Arrive for class, work, shopping, or an appointment.
Respond to delays or schedule changes.
Plan the trip home and next responsibility.
